网络财务软件用什么编程
1. 背景介绍
随着互联网和信息技术的快速发展,网络财务软件在企业财务管理中扮演着越来越重要的角色。网络财务软件以其高效的财务处理能力、的数据分析和准确的报表生成功能,成为了企业管理者进行财务分析和决策的重要工具。
2. 网络财务软件的编程语言选择
在开发网络财务软件时,选择合适的编程语言对于软件的质量和性能至关重要。以下是一些常用的编程语言:
2.1 Java
Java是一种广泛使用的编程语言,具有可移植性强、安全性高、性能优异等特点。其庞大的类库和丰富的开源工具使得开发者能够更加便捷地构建稳定的网络财务软件。
2.2 C#
C#是面向对象的编程语言,由微软公司开发。该语言在Windows平台上具有较好的兼容性和性能表现,适合开发运行在Windows操作系统上的网络财务软件。
2.3 Python
Python是一种简洁而强大的编程语言,在开发网络财务软件时被广泛使用。其易学易用、拓展性高的特点使得开发者能够更快地构建出功能完善、稳定可靠的网络财务软件。
2.4 JavaScript
JavaScript是一种脚本语言,用于在网页上实现动态交互。在网络财务软件开发中,JavaScript通常与HTML和CSS一同使用,用于实现前端的界面和交互逻辑。
2.5 Ruby
Ruby是一种简单而优雅的编程语言,具有简单易学、开发快速的特点。其的Web框架Ruby on Rails使得使用Ruby开发网络财务软件变得更加高效和便捷。
3. 网络财务软件的功能与需求
网络财务软件的功能和需求各有不同,但一般包括以下几个方面:
3.1 财务数据管理
网络财务软件需要能够对企业的财务数据进行有效的管理,包括会计科目的录入、账簿的生成、凭证的制作以及财务报表的生成等。
3.2 财务分析与报告
网络财务软件需要能够对财务数据进行分析,并生成相应的报表和图表,帮助企业管理者了解财务状况、进行决策分析。
3.3 预算与成本控制
网络财务软件需要提供预算编制和成本控制的功能,帮助企业制定预算计划并监控实际支出与预算的差异。
3.4 风险管理
网络财务软件需要能够对企业的财务风险进行分析和管理,包括对市场风险、信用风险、操作风险等方面的评估和控制。
4. 开发网络财务软件的注意事项
在开发网络财务软件时,需要注意以下几点:
4.1 安全性
网络财务软件处理的是企业的重要财务数据,需要保障数据的安全性。开发者需要在系统的设计中考虑到安全措施,如数据加密、访问权限控制等。
4.2 用户友好性
网络财务软件需要具备良好的用户友好性,方便用户进行操作和查看财务数据。开发者需要考虑用户的使用习惯和操作习惯,设计出简洁、直观的界面。
4.3 可拓展性
网络财务软件需要具备良好的可拓展性,方便在后续的业务扩展中快速、便捷地新增功能。开发者需要使用灵活的架构和技术,设计可扩展的软件系统。
5. 总结
网络财务软件的开发需要选择适合的编程语言,并根据功能需求和用户体验进行设计和开发。在开发过程中,保障软件的安全性、用户友好性和可拓展性是至关重要的。
Java、C#、Python、JavaScript和Ruby是常见的网络财务软件开发的编程语言选择。它们各自具有不同的特点和适用场景,开发者可以根据具体的需求和技术背景选择合适的语言进行开发。
上一篇: 给代理商现金奖励如何入账
下一篇: 网络营销财务软件哪个好用